Northern Berkshire Project Warm

This community program is supported by local organizations that provide warm winter coats, snow pants, hats, gloves and scarves to children in need in advance of winter each October.

North Adams' Born Learning Trail

Born Learning Trails are a United Way campaign for developing early childhood learning and parental engagement with community partners. The North Adams trail was sponsored by the Northern Berkshire United Way, one of the ways the agency is seeking to more directly give back to community.

Community Needs & Special Grants

The Community Needs and Special Grants Committee reviews data on well-being and community issues then recommends to NBUW’s Board of Directors priorities for funding, membership, and other decisions.

 

Special 1-time and major long-term grants for local needs come from Northern Berkshire United Way’s own funds.
